Why Is Bloom Energy Corporation (BE) Stock Up +6% Today?

Why Is Bloom Energy Corporation (BE) Stock Up +6% Today?

Key Takeaways

  • Shares of Bloom Energy Corporation (BE) are trading up approximately 6% in premarket action on July 1, 2026, following a major expansion of its AI infrastructure financing partnership.
  • The primary catalyst is Brookfield Asset Management's decision to increase its commitment to fund Bloom-powered AI data center projects from $5 billion to $25 billion.
  • The deal reinforces Bloom Energy's positioning as a key power supplier for the rapidly growing AI and data center buildout, a theme that has driven the stock's massive rally over the past year.
  • Wells Fargo reiterated an Equal Weight rating and $217 price target following the news, even as the stock trades well above that level, signaling a divide between bullish momentum and some analysts' valuation caution.
  • Broader clean-energy and fuel-cell peers, including FuelCell Energy (FCEL), have also seen elevated trading activity as investor attention on power-for-AI infrastructure themes intensifies.
  • Traders are watching whether the stock can hold gains near its 52-week high and how the expanded Brookfield commitment translates into concrete order volume in coming quarters.

Opening Summary

Bloom Energy Corporation (BE) designs and manufactures solid oxide fuel cell systems that generate on-site electricity for data centers, industrial facilities, and other commercial customers. Shares are trading up roughly 6% in premarket action, rising from a prior close near $302.70 to around $320.86. The gain confirms a bullish reaction after Brookfield Asset Management announced it would expand its financing commitment for Bloom-powered AI infrastructure projects fivefold, from $5 billion to $25 billion. The immediate reason cited by markets is heightened confidence in Bloom's growth pipeline tied to surging electricity demand from artificial intelligence data centers.

Brookfield Partnership Expansion Fuels the Rally

The dominant catalyst behind Wednesday's premarket gain is the substantial scale-up of Bloom Energy's financing partnership with Brookfield, which now stands at $25 billion earmarked for deploying Bloom's fuel cell systems to power AI data centers. The expanded commitment signals strong institutional confidence in demand for on-site, grid-independent power solutions as data center operators race to secure reliable electricity outside of traditional utility infrastructure. Shares had already jumped roughly 10% in after-hours trading following the initial announcement, with premarket gains carrying that momentum into Wednesday's session.

Analyst Response Shows Mixed Signals

Despite the bullish news, Wells Fargo reiterated its Equal Weight rating on Bloom Energy shares, maintaining a $217 price target that sits well below the stock's current trading level. This divergence highlights ongoing debate among analysts about whether Bloom's valuation, after surging more than 1,200% over the past year, has outpaced near-term fundamentals despite the company's improving order backlog. The mixed analyst commentary suggests that while the Brookfield news is fundamentally positive, some on Wall Street view the stock's rapid appreciation with caution.

Sector Momentum and AI Power Demand Theme

Bloom Energy's move is part of a broader investor rotation into companies positioned to benefit from the AI infrastructure buildout, particularly those addressing the electricity supply constraints facing new data centers. Fuel cell peer FuelCell Energy (FCEL) has also seen a substantial rally recently, reflecting sector-wide enthusiasm for alternative power technologies tied to AI demand. This sympathy move underscores that Bloom's gain, while driven by company-specific news, is reinforced by a favorable sector backdrop.

Market Context and Trading Activity

Premarket trading volume in Bloom Energy shares is running well above typical levels, consistent with a reaction to material corporate news. The stock is approaching its 52-week high near $351.28, and Wednesday's gains extend a volatile recent stretch that included an 18% pullback followed by a partial rebound tied to index-related trading flows. Broader equity indices are not showing comparable moves, indicating the rally is company- and theme-specific rather than a reflection of broad market strength.

What Comes Next for BE

Investors will be watching for further details on how the expanded Brookfield partnership translates into firm orders and revenue recognition timelines in upcoming quarters. Bloom Energy's next earnings report will be closely scrutinized for updates on backlog growth, margin trends, and progress on manufacturing capacity expansion to meet rising demand. Analysts are likely to continue revising price targets as the AI power demand narrative evolves, while broader developments in data center construction and energy policy could also influence sentiment. Key risks include execution challenges in scaling production, potential volatility in the stock following its outsized year-long rally, and the pace at which Brookfield's financing commitment converts into actual deployed capacity.

Industry description

The industry produces a diverse range of electricity-powered equipment, appliances and components, catering to both households and industries. The products include power, distribution and specialty transformers; electric motors, generators and motor-generator sets; switchgear and switchboard apparatus; light bulbs, tubes, fittings and electric signs etc. Consumer income, construction spending, and industrial production are major drivers of demand for this industry’s products. Large companies tend to have economies of scale in production, marketing, and distribution, while smaller companies can potentially carve out their own market through niche or specialty offerings. The US electrical products manufacturing industry includes about 5,700 establishments (single-location companies and units of multi-location companies) with combined annual revenue of about $125 billion. (according to a study published in First Research). Emerson Electric Co., Hubbell Incorporated and Eaton Corporation plc are major electrical products makers in the U.S.
